On Wednesday, 24 June 2026 at 22:42, a Coastguard Helicopter departed from Cornwall Airport Newquay to St. Mary's Airport. It was the Coastguard Helicopter with registration number G-MCGI. The flight lasted 47 minutes. During that period, the aircraft travelled 73 miles at an average speed of 94 miles per hour at a maximum altitude of 1225 feet.

The helicopter G-MCGI is used by the British Coastguard. The helicopter is deployed in search and rescue operations at sea, rescue operations involving ships or drilling platforms, patrols to prevent smuggling or piracy, environmental monitoring and disaster relief support.
